#home[data-v-3bd6e66e]{display:grid;align-items:center;justify-items:center;grid-template-rows:1.25fr 1fr .5fr .75fr;padding:0;background-color:#e6e7e2;text-align:center}#leaves[data-v-3bd6e66e]{width:100%;min-width:0;min-height:0;-o-object-fit:cover;object-fit:cover;-o-object-position:bottom;object-position:bottom;align-self:start}#name[data-v-3bd6e66e]{width:50%;min-width:0;min-height:0;-o-object-fit:contain;object-fit:contain}#date[data-v-3bd6e66e]{font-size:50px}@media (max-width:800px){nav[data-v-3bd6e66e]{flex-direction:column}#leaves[data-v-3bd6e66e]{width:200%}#name[data-v-3bd6e66e]{width:90%;align-self:start}}nav[data-v-3bd6e66e]{display:flex;justify-content:space-evenly;padding-bottom:30px}nav a[data-v-3bd6e66e]{text-decoration:none;font-weight:700;color:#2c3e50;margin:5px 20px}.map[data-v-3bd6e66e]{width:90%;height:70%;margin-top:3%}a[data-v-5025d736]{width:50px;height:50px;position:absolute;top:10px;right:10px}img[data-v-5025d736]{width:100%;height:100%;color:red}.gm-style-iw button{display:none!important}.gm-style-iw,.gm-style-iw-t:after{background:#f5f1e6!important}.gm-style-iw{padding-right:12px!important;padding-bottom:12px!important;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.gm-style-iw-d{overflow:hidden!important}.navlink svg{width:30px;fill:#abb97c}#church[data-v-0b3acb4e]{background-color:#d5d8ce;display:flex;justify-content:space-between}.text[data-v-0b3acb4e]{display:flex;flex-direction:column;justify-content:center;font-size:clamp(10px,5vw,min(40px,8vh))}@media (max-width:800px){#church[data-v-0b3acb4e]{flex-direction:column}}.map[data-v-0b3acb4e],.text[data-v-0b3acb4e]{flex:1;margin:1%}#party[data-v-12c44876]{background-color:#e2e5de;display:flex;justify-content:space-between}.text[data-v-12c44876]{font-size:clamp(10px,5vw,min(40px,8vh));overflow-y:auto}.text p[data-v-12c44876]{margin-top:10px}@media (max-width:800px){#party[data-v-12c44876]{flex-direction:column}}.map[data-v-12c44876],.text[data-v-12c44876]{flex:1;margin:1%}#photos[data-v-ab0da568]{background-color:#f0f2eb;padding:50px;display:grid;grid-template-columns:1fr 1fr 1fr 1fr;grid-template-rows:30% 30% 30%;grid-gap:50px;grid-template-areas:"p1 p2 p2 p3" "p4 p4 p5 p3" "p4 p4 p6 p7"}@media (max-width:800px){#photos[data-v-ab0da568]{grid-template-columns:1fr 1fr 1fr;grid-template-rows:1fr 1fr 1fr 1fr;grid-gap:20px;grid-template-areas:"p1 p2 p2" "p4 p4 p3" "p4 p4 p3" "p5 p5 p7"}#p6[data-v-ab0da568]{display:none}}@media (min-width:800px) and (max-height:800px){#photos[data-v-ab0da568]{grid-template-columns:1fr 1fr 1fr;grid-template-rows:1fr 1fr;grid-gap:20px;grid-template-areas:"p4 p1 p7" "p4 p5 p7"}#p2[data-v-ab0da568],#p3[data-v-ab0da568],#p6[data-v-ab0da568]{display:none}}img[data-v-ab0da568]{width:100%;height:100%;min-width:0;min-height:0;-o-object-fit:cover;object-fit:cover}#p1[data-v-ab0da568]{grid-area:p1}#p2[data-v-ab0da568]{grid-area:p2}#p3[data-v-ab0da568]{grid-area:p3}#p4[data-v-ab0da568]{grid-area:p4}#p5[data-v-ab0da568]{grid-area:p5}#p6[data-v-ab0da568]{grid-area:p6}a[data-v-ab0da568]{grid-area:p7;text-decoration:none;font-weight:700;color:#2c3e50}a img[data-v-ab0da568]{margin:-30px}#right[data-v-ab0da568]{width:50%;height:50%}#countdown[data-v-63b84678]{background-color:#bec4ab;display:inline-flex;justify-content:space-between;align-items:stretch}#text[data-v-63b84678]{width:50%;display:flex;flex-direction:column;justify-content:center}#text h2[data-v-63b84678]{margin-bottom:50px}table[data-v-63b84678]{margin:auto}td[data-v-63b84678]:first-child{width:50px;text-align:right}td[data-v-63b84678]:nth-child(2){padding-left:10px;text-align:left}#countdown img[data-v-63b84678]{-o-object-fit:cover;object-fit:cover;width:50%}@media (max-width:800px){#text[data-v-63b84678]{width:100%}#countdown img[data-v-63b84678]{display:none}}#vertical[data-v-63b84678]{display:block}#horizontal[data-v-63b84678]{display:none}@media (max-height:470px){#horizontal[data-v-63b84678]{display:block}#vertical[data-v-63b84678]{display:none}}#stream[data-v-061b45c2]{background-color:#f0f2eb}#app,#embed[data-v-061b45c2],body,html{width:100%;height:100%}#app,body,html{overflow:hidden;scroll-behavior:smooth}#app{font-family:Avenir,Helvetica,Arial,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-align:center;overflow-y:scroll;-ms-scroll-snap-type:y mandatory;scroll-snap-type:y mandatory}.slide{width:100%;height:100%;font-family:Amatic SC,cursive;box-sizing:border-box;padding:50px;position:relative;scroll-snap-align:start;overflow:hidden}.slide,.slide h2{font-size:40px}